How Emotions Disrupt Thoracic Harmony
Grief contracts lungs, cutting oxygen, leading to shallow breath and low mood. Fear overactivates heart, causing skips or pressure. TCM links these: lungs process letting go, heart guards spirit. Blocked qi creates 'oppression' – that full, heavy feeling.
